探索香港CN2服务器的缓存机制:提升性能与用户体验
香港CN2服务器为了提升性能与用户体验,通常会采用多种缓存机制和技术,以下是其中一些关键点:
1. **CDN缓存服务集成**:通过将香港CN2服务器与内容分发网络(CDN)服务集成,可以显著提升数据传输速度和响应时间。CDN在全球范围内设立多个边缘节点,将网站的静态内容(如图片、视频、样式表、脚本文件等)缓存至这些节点上。当用户访问网站时,CDN会将内容从距离用户最近的节点提供给用户,减少了数据传输的距离,从而缩短加载时间,提升用户体验。
2. **本地缓存**:服务器端可以实施本地缓存策略,对频繁访问的数据或计算结果进行临时存储。这样,当相同的请求再次到达时,可以直接从缓存中读取,避免了重复的数据库查询或复杂的计算过程,提升了响应速度。
3. **数据库缓存**:对于数据库操作,可以使用如Redis、Memcached等内存缓存系统,存储热点数据或查询结果,减少对数据库的直接访问,降低延迟,提高数据库的处理能力。
4. **反向代理缓存**:通过部署反向代理服务器(如Nginx),可以在服务器层面缓存动态内容,减轻后端服务器的压力,提高网站的可用性和响应速度。反向代理可以智能地处理缓存过期、更新策略,确保用户访问的是最新数据。
5. **浏览器缓存**:通过设置HTTP头部指令,如Cache-Control、ETag、Last-Modified等,指导用户的浏览器缓存资源,使得在后续访问时直接使用本地缓存,无需重新下载,进一步加快页面加载速度。
6. **协议优化与压缩**:香港CN2服务器还可能利用HTTP/2或HTTP/3等协议,这些协议在设计上优化了数据传输效率,支持多路复用、头部压缩等功能,减少了网络传输的开销。同时,服务器可以对输出内容进行Gzip压缩,减小数据体积,加快传输速度。
通过上述缓存机制的综合应用,香港CN2服务器能够有效应对跨国网络传输的挑战,减少延迟,提高数据传输效率,确保用户在全球范围内获得稳定、快速的访问体验。